Bolt-bats are a form of wildlife native to both Cybertron and Nebulos. They presumably are easily shocked and amazed by new sights.

Fiction

[edit]

Generation 1 cartoon continuity

[edit]

The Transformers cartoon

[edit]

Sideswipe referred to Cybertronic bolt-bats, implying that there were also bolt-bats native to other planets. S.O.S. Dinobots

The Headmasters cartoon

[edit]

While traversing the tunnels to place a bomb at Vector Sigma, Mindwipe was attacked by a swarm of giant bolt-bats. Mindwipe pleaded with them to stop attacking a fellow bat to little effect and fell down a flight of stairs to escape the animals. Cybertron Is in Grave Danger, Part 2

Beast Wars: Uprising

[edit]

The ex-Autobot Leatherhide adopted a bolt-bat alternate mode as part of his experiments. Not All Megatrons Bisk would later come across giant bolt-bats while exploring the bowels of Cybertron. The Inexorable March

Notes

[edit]
  • The AllSpark Almanac II declared Skar to be a Nebulan bolt-bat.
  • The bolt-bats in The Headmasters were not named in the episode, only being called "denki kōmori" (電機コウモリ, "electric bat") on the model sheet. Their identification as "bolt-bats" came decades later in Beast Wars: Uprising.
